Solution 1

It converts all headers into an array

// create curl resource
$ch = curl_init();

// set url
cur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_URL, "example.com");

//return the transfer as a string
cur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_RETURNTRANSFER, 1);
//enable headers
cur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_HEADER, 1);
//get only headers
cur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_NOBODY, 1);
// $output contains the output string
$output = curl_exec($ch);

// close curl resource to free up system resources
curl_close($ch);

$headers = [];
$output = rtrim($output);
$data = explode("\n",$output);
$headers['status'] = $data[0];
array_shift($data);

foreach($data as $part){

    //some headers will contain ":" character (Location for example), and the part after ":" will be lost, Thanks to @Emanuele
    $middle = explode(":",$part,2);

    //Supress warning message if $middle[1] does not exist, Thanks to @crayons
    if ( !isset($middle[1]) ) { $middle[1] = null; }

    $headers[trim($middle[0])] = trim($middle[1]);
}

// Print all headers as array
echo "<pre>";
print_r($headers);
echo "</pre>";

Solution 2

For the first answer note that the code:

$middle=explode(":",$part);

will produce wrong results with string data containing :, like for example:

Sat, 14 Jan 2017 01:10:01 GMT

The correct code to split the fields to build the array would be like:

$middle=explode(":",$part,2);

    I am new to PHP. I am trying to get the Header from the response after sending the php curl POST request. The client sends the request to the server and server sends back the response with Header. Here is how I sent my POST request.

       $client = curl_init($url);  
       curl_setopt($client, CURLOPT_CUSTOMREQUEST, "POST");
       curl_setopt($client, CURLOPT_POSTFIELDS, $data_string);
       curl_setopt($client, CURLOPT_HEADER, 1);
       $response = curl_exec($client);
       var_dump($response);
    

    Here is the Header response from server that I get from the browser

    HTTP/1.1 200 OK 
    Date: Wed, 01 Feb 2017 11:40:59 GMT 
    Authorization: eyJhbGciOiJIUzI1NiJ9.eyJzdWIiOiJ1c2Vycy9CYW9CaW5oMTEwMiIsIm5hbWUiOiJhZG1pbiIsInBhc3N3b3JkIjoiMTIzNCJ9.kIGghbKQtMowjUZ6g62KirdfDUA_HtmW-wjqc3ROXjc Content-Type: text/html;charset=utf-8 Transfer-Encoding: chunked Server: Jetty(9.3.6.v20151106) 
    

    How can I extract the Authorization part from the Header ?. I need to store it in the cookies
